3.6 Saving your Abaqus/CAE GUI settings

When you exit Abaqus/CAE, your current GUI settings are stored in a binary file called abaqus_v6.9.gpr in your home directory. When you start a new session, Abaqus/CAE loads this file and applies the settings. You cannot edit the abaqus_v6.9.gpr file; however, you can delete it to restore the default GUI settings.

Warning:  Deleting the abaqus_v6.9.gpr file resets all of the GUI settings listed above. You cannot restore the settings from a deleted abaqus_v6.9.gpr file except by recreating them manually in Abaqus/CAE.

In addition, you can save your modified display options settings (for example, the render style; the visibility of the various types of datum geometry; and the display of mesh, element, and node labels.) You can save your customized display options settings in abaqus_v6.9.gpr in your home directory and apply them to all your Abaqus/CAE sessions. Alternatively, you can save these settings in a version of abaqus_v6.9.gpr in the current directory and apply them only to subsequent sessions that you start from that directory. For more information, see Saving your display options settings, Section 72.15.
